When the body of journalist Duncan Brown is found in the back of a rubbish truck, Inspector John Carlyle is thrown into the middle of a scandal that threatens to expose the corrupt links between the police, the political establishment, and the hugely powerful Zenger media group. Hunting down Brown's killer, Carlyle finds himself going head to head with his nemesis, Trevor Miller. A former police officer turned security adviser to the Prime Minister, Miller has dirty money in his pockets and other people's blood on his hands. Untouchable until now, he is prepared to kill again to protect his position.

Nothing bad ever happens in the quiet little town of Hope. However, when the circus rolls in one misty morning in late October, everyone decides to go see what they have. Even the Jorgenson family and their 8 year old son Noah head on down to the circus big top, but when it is time to leave he is nowhere to be found. With the help of Sheriff Langley, his parents search the premises, but they don't find him. Now that it is closing time, they are forced to leave in hopes that he will come home. Will they ever find him and all the other children that have gone missing from other towns?

This adventure sees Smarty leave his Secret Valley in the South West of Australia, exploring the nearby town of Donnybrook to investigate a big new circus tent which has been erected on the town oval. Smarty encounters exotic animals including a lion, a tiger, an elephant and a huge reticulated python. The lion and the python try to eat Smarty but, as always, our clever hero escapes and while running away, inadvertently finds himself in the main circus arena, inside the massive tent.
